Fresh-Cut Trees vs. Pre-Lit Options: What Works Best for You?
When it’s time to pick the tree, it’s a matter of personality and convenience. Fresh-cut Christmas trees bring the outdoors in, filling your home with the unmistakable scent of pine or fir. Selecting the right one—testing branches and inspecting the trunk—can feel like a fun, family-wide adventure.
But let’s talk pre-lit Christmas trees. These marvels of modern design save hours untangling lights and wrestling with evenly spaced coverage. My neighbor swears by hers; she said the time saved meant one more hand for cookie decorating! Newer pre-lit options feature adjustable lighting modes, from warm twinkles to cool white.
